| Guidelines for Development
of Namaste Nepal Community Association’s (NNCA)
Programs:
Identity: NNCA (Namaste Radio)
is a registered non-profit Nepalese Canadian
Community Media Organization without any religious,
political and governmental affiliation.
We are working towards registering it a Charity
Organization.
Namaste Radio Team shall try its best to meet
the expectation of its audience and at the same
time maintain the identity of the organization.
Points below are guiding principles for developing
programs to be aired.
- Any program to be aired by NNCA, shall reflect
the identity of the organization
- Programs shall be related to NNCA’s purpose
- NNCA shall not air any program that majority
of Nepalese people do not want . To know the
choice of our listeners NNCA shall conduct
opinion surveys of members and selected non-members
- NNCA shall carefully determine the appropriateness
of programs before airing
- NNCA shall categorize its audiences into
children, youths and adults. Accordingly the
programs shall be entertaining, educational,
intellectual, informative and inspirational
- Music, news, events, interviews, quiz contests,
singing contests, children and youth debates,
etc. shall be considered suitable programs
to be developed and aired by NNCA
- NNCA shall announce events organized by
Nepalese Community Organizations or the Nepalese
people. However, NNCA expects at least one
weeks notice in advance for convenience
- NNCA shall interview only prominent personalities;
personalities that inspire. Stories of success,
leadership, good deed, outstanding writing,
musical talent, will power and character shall
be considered inspirational
- Every developed program shall be scrutinized
and passed by the Program Development Team
before its broadcasting
- It is clear and understood that NNCA does
not and shall not have affiliation with any
political or religious cause
- NNCA shall commit itself to democratic values.
It shall also commit to values like honesty,
integrity, diversity, creativity and excellence
in service
- Language (Nepali or English) for the program shall depend on the target audience
The above Principles have been passed by the Board of Directors on the 18 day of June, 2006 and as of this date NNCA (Namaste Radio) shall adhere to the above principles while developing and broadcasting each and every program. In case a difficult situation arises, a special meeting of the Board shall be called to decide and resolve the issue.
